knot noun

  /nɑt/ , /nɒt/
  • A looping of a piece of string or of any other long, flexible material that cannot be untangled without passing one or both ends of the material through its loops.
  • (of hair, etc) A tangled clump.
  • (mathematics) A non-self-intersecting closed curve in (e.g., three-dimensional) space that is an abstraction of a knot (in sense 1 above).
  • A difficult situation.
  • The whorl left in lumber by the base of a branch growing out of the tree's trunk.
  • (aviation) A unit of indicated airspeed, calibrated airspeed, or equivalent airspeed, which varies in its relation to the unit of speed so as to compensate for the effects of different ambient atmospheric conditions on aircraft performance.
  • A maze-like pattern.
